## Runbook: Gaugepile Sidecar — Release Checklist

Heads up: the sidecar ships with every app pod, so a bad config fans out fast. Before cutting a release, confirm the flush interval hasn't drifted from what the Tallyhouse aggregator expects, or you'll see sawtooth gaps in dashboards. Rollbacks are cheap — just repin the image tag. Canary one node pool first, watch for ten minutes, then proceed. The values to verify against are these.

config for bagep-yafof:
quenath:
  pin: 8584
  metrics_host: metrics.quenath.tolvaqsys.internal
  tenant: pelath
  seal: seal_ed102645

Ticket: Staging env misconfigured for Siftgate bloom filter

The bloom layer in front of the Pellet KV store is rejecting all lookups in staging because the env file was copied from the dev template without credentials. False-positive tuning values are fine; only the auth line is missing. To unblock the weekly demo, the Pellet admission secret must be set on the following line.

env line for yaguf-fajop: LEDGER_TOKEN13=fb08984397349

Ticket: SDK parity gap between Brindlewick's Kotlin and Swift clients. The staging environment for the Swift SDK was pointed at the legacy auth endpoint, so token refresh tests pass on Kotlin only. Repoint staging and re-run the parity suite. Add the following line to the staging env file before rerunning.

secret setting of yajog-taguf: ARCHIVE_KEY3=051